Teclast F6 Pro Notebook 13.3 inch Intel Core m3-7Y30 8GB/128GB SSD Fingerprint Recognition

【Flash Deal- Get in fast!】: 【Teclast F6 Pro】: 【Mobile Phones & Accessories】: ...
Back to Top